  • :43 what is the reason for the adjustable throttle bodies, that struck my interest

  • @Erv187 long stack for torque at low RPM, short stack for high RPM.

  • @OpeiGrafikka that is awesome. I wonder if that could be possible for an N/A 13b bridgeported or Peripheral Port engine or something, I'm sure that set up is super expensive

  • @Erv187 Would be relatively easy to modify an existing variable stack to suit, though the tuning map could take some time to get right. There are a few Mazda, Honda and Vauxhall 6 and 8 cyl engines running variable stack or 'variable charge' intakes from factory, though I believe the Mazda and Vauxhall variety use a valve system to mimic the resonance of a shorter or longer stack.

  • The difference in length is to achieve a pulse frequency of the intake opening vacuum being met by a velocity pulse of air returning the intake vacuum from the previous cycle to median air density.

    if the length of the velocity stack is the right length for the delay required at a given RPM, the pulse of air hits the intake valves milliseconds after they open, helping the charge the cylinder with as much air as is possible without a forced charge system.

    It's a beautiful thing.

  • @FaytTang My favourite subject... The rule changes were planned and set in stone not later than 1989/1990. 1991, when Mazda won, was already a transitional year with two categories of cars. Merc-Sauber, Jaguar and newcomer Peugeot had already built cars for the new rules. Since the rule change also "banned" turbo engine and anything larger than 3.5L, most of the grid needed new engines. "Case Mazda", back then merely a coincidence, now somehow a worldwide conspiracy against wankel.
